Wow, great visible pass, rising out of the north west, and going straight overhead before winking out.  I couldn't see much in the way of structure, even with binoculars, but it was really bright.

I heard sstv, and had my PC running a live capture into QSSTV on my Linux box.  The program decoded it as Robot36, but the picture is just a bunch of nearly horizontal colored stripes, like a TV set that is way out of sync.  You can see that there was some text at the bottom, but it's illegible.  

I used the same setup with Richard a few months ago, and got some beautiful pictures.  What format was Charles using?
